Technically a cPanel install does not need to have an active license to back it up over SSH or via the WHM API. You would need a VPS with root access to use the API

Even wil cPanel disabled you should be able to connect to FTP to get your files and connect to MySQL to get your databases. Its a little bit more manual labor but you should be able to get everything without having to get a cPanel backup.
